Learning outcomes: • knowledge of purpose, function and properties of distributed systems for collecting, processing and control in electric power systems; • knowledge of principles of construction of modern automated process control systems using SCADA systems; • understanding algorithms of functioning systems of data collection and management; • ability to apply the tools of SCADA-systems; • ability to design and setup automated control systems.
Required prior and related subjects: • Programming in Microsoft Visual Studio Environment.
Summary of the subject: Information technology and systems. Technical means of information gathering and control. Digital signal processing. Automated control systems (ACS). SCADA-systems: basic concepts and definitions; functions and architecture; organization of information exchange; display of operational information and remote control; top level software; development tools for SCADA-systems. Automated dispatch system MicroSCADA from company ABB. Information and control systems (ICS) for substations.
